首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在单击元素alpinejs时获取数据属性

,Alpine.js是一个轻量级的JavaScript框架,用于在前端开发中添加交互性。它可以使HTML元素具有动态行为,包括获取和操作数据属性。

要在单击元素alpinejs时获取数据属性,可以按照以下步骤进行:

  1. 在HTML代码中,添加一个元素并使用x-data指令来定义一个Alpine.js组件。
代码语言:txt
复制
<div x-data="{ dataAttribute: 'default value' }">
  <button x-on:click="console.log(dataAttribute)">点击获取数据属性</button>
</div>

在这个例子中,我们创建了一个名为dataAttribute的数据属性,并将其初始值设置为"default value"。按钮元素被绑定到x-on:click事件,当点击按钮时,会在控制台中输出dataAttribute的值。

  1. 如果要在单击元素时更新数据属性的值,可以使用x-on:click事件指令,并在事件处理函数中更新属性的值。
代码语言:txt
复制
<div x-data="{ dataAttribute: 'default value' }">
  <button x-on:click="dataAttribute = 'new value'">点击更新数据属性</button>
</div>

在这个例子中,当点击按钮时,dataAttribute的值将被更新为"new value"。

Alpine.js的优势在于它的轻量级和易用性,可以快速地为网页添加交互功能,而无需引入复杂的框架或库。它适用于各种应用场景,包括表单验证、动态内容加载、条件渲染等。

腾讯云的相关产品中,暂时没有特定与Alpine.js相关的产品。但是腾讯云的云计算服务包括计算、存储、网络等方面的产品,可以帮助用户构建和管理基于云计算的应用和服务。您可以查阅腾讯云的官方网站以了解更多相关产品和详细信息。

注意:在回答中不提及特定的品牌商,只是提供一般性的解答和信息。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 领券